The (often titled Piping Equipment: Mastering Fluids ) is a foundational reference guide used by engineers and contractors in the oil, gas, and energy industries. Originally published by the Trouvay & Cauvin Group , a global piping solutions provider established in 1881, the handbook serves as a comprehensive technical catalog for piping materials, specifications, and design standards.
